Transaction 50309e517a75b37f32c57c39475dbf30cb5fbe9d29c08922c850e03a9e5817d5

1 Input
2 Outputs
  • 50309e517a75b37f32c57c39475dbf30cb5fbe9d29c08922c850e03a9e5817d5:0
  • value  1012677
    address  1Dx52pT9WvKvgAzCHnyFWQ4BdGPhZLkFnz
  • 50309e517a75b37f32c57c39475dbf30cb5fbe9d29c08922c850e03a9e5817d5:1
  • value  251292
    address  1GddsNcfSt5h5VbyNCG1L9KZwZZ8RdaNFQ